4 sill timber
1) Геология: деревянный лежень2) Техника: лежень3) Строительство: брус, поперечина4) Архитектура: геленг (горизонтальный брус, служащий основанием для различных частей постройки или бревно с отвеской только на один или два канта) -

sill — O.E. syll beam, large timber serving as a foundation of a wall, from P.Gmc. *suljo (Cf. O.N. svill framework of a building, M.L.G. sull, O.H.G. swelli, Ger. Schwelle sill ), perhaps from PIE root *swel post, board (Cf. Gk. selma beam ). Meaning … Etymology dictionary
